Freelance hiring models compared
Four common paths. Pick by engagement length and risk tolerance:
| Engagement | Rate (India) | Start time | Best for | Risk |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Marketplace freelancer (Upwork/Fiverr) | $10 – $35/hr | 3–10 days | Short fixes < 2 weeks | Quality variance, ghosting |
| Pre-vetted freelancer (Toptal/Witarist) Recommended | $25 – $80/hr | 48 hours | Sprint help, specialist gaps | Slightly higher rate |
| Dedicated developer (full-time contract) | $25 – $80/hr | 48 hours | 3+ month engagements | Time-zone management |
| Direct freelance (your own network) | $15 – $60/hr | 1–3 days | Repeat collaborators | No replacement safety net |
Pricing models: which one to use
Beyond the hourly rate, the pricing structure shapes incentives:
| Pricing model | When it works | When it backfires |
|---|---|---|
| Hourly | Scope is fluid; you want pay-as-you-go | Freelancer drags out hours; no incentive to ship fast |
| Fixed-price (per project) | Spec is locked, deliverables are crisp | Scope creep → "out of contract" haggling |
| Milestone-based | Clear deliverable stages, partial payments | Milestone definitions slip — write them tightly |
| Retainer (monthly) | Ongoing support, predictable burn | Used hours always fill the retainer ("Parkinson's law") |
Red flags when hiring freelance developers
| Red flag | What to ask |
|---|---|
| 5-star rating but only 3 projects | "Walk me through your largest past project." |
| Generic CV with no GitHub | "Send me a recent PR you're proud of." |
| Promises sub-market rate | "What corners are you cutting to hit this price?" |
| Won't take a paid test | Walk away |
| Vague time-zone availability | "What 4-hour live overlap can you commit to?" |
| Always available, never busy | Likely juggling 5 clients silently |
